We are excited to announce the developer preview of our new API documentation for AWS SDK for JavaScript v3. Please follow instructions on the landing page to leave us your feedback.
Readonly
configThe resolved configuration of DataExchangeClient class. This is resolved and normalized from the constructor configuration interface.
Optional
options: HttpHandlerOptionsOptional
data: CancelJobCommandOutputOptional
data: CancelJobCommandOutputOptional
options: HttpHandlerOptionsOptional
data: CreateDataSetCommandOutputOptional
data: CreateDataSet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: CreateEventActionCommandOutputOptional
data: CreateEventAction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: CreateJobCommandOutputOptional
data: CreateJobCommandOutputOptional
options: HttpHandlerOptionsOptional
data: CreateRevisionCommandOutputOptional
data: CreateRevision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: DeleteAssetCommandOutputOptional
data: DeleteAsset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: DeleteDataSetCommandOutputOptional
data: DeleteDataSet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: DeleteEventActionCommandOutputOptional
data: DeleteEventAction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: DeleteRevisionCommandOutputOptional
data: DeleteRevisionCommandOutputDestroy underlying resources, like sockets. It's usually not necessary to do this. However in Node.js, it's best to explicitly shut down the client's agent when it is no longer needed. Otherwise, sockets might stay open for quite a long time before the server terminates them.
Optional
options: HttpHandlerOptionsOptional
data: GetAssetCommandOutputOptional
data: GetAsset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: GetDataSetCommandOutputOptional
data: GetDataSet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: GetEventActionCommandOutputOptional
data: GetEventAction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: GetJobCommandOutputOptional
data: GetJobCommandOutputOptional
options: HttpHandlerOptionsOptional
data: GetRevisionCommandOutputOptional
data: GetRevision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: ListDataSetRevisionsCommandOutputOptional
data: ListDataSetRevisionsCommandOutputOptional
options: HttpHandlerOptionsOptional
data: ListDataSetsCommandOutputOptional
data: ListDataSetsCommandOutputOptional
options: HttpHandlerOptionsOptional
data: ListEventActionsCommandOutputOptional
data: ListEventActionsCommandOutputOptional
options: HttpHandlerOptionsOptional
data: ListJobsCommandOutputOptional
data: ListJobsCommandOutputOptional
options: HttpHandlerOptionsOptional
data: ListRevisionAssetsCommandOutputOptional
data: ListRevisionAssetsCommandOutputOptional
options: HttpHandlerOptionsOptional
data: ListTagsForResourceCommandOutputOptional
data: ListTagsForResourceCommandOutputOptional
options: HttpHandlerOptionsOptional
data: RevokeRevisionCommandOutputOptional
data: RevokeRevision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: OutputTypeOptional
data: OutputTypeOptional
options: HttpHandlerOptionsOptional
data: SendApiAssetCommandOutputOptional
data: SendApiAsset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: StartJobCommandOutputOptional
data: StartJobCommandOutputOptional
options: HttpHandlerOptionsOptional
data: TagResourceCommandOutputOptional
data: TagResourceCommandOutputOptional
options: HttpHandlerOptionsOptional
data: UntagResourceCommandOutputOptional
data: UntagResourceCommandOutputOptional
options: HttpHandlerOptionsOptional
data: UpdateAssetCommandOutputOptional
data: UpdateAsset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: UpdateDataSetCommandOutputOptional
data: UpdateDataSetCommandOutputOptional
options: HttpHandlerOptionsOptional
data: UpdateEventActionCommandOutputOptional
data: UpdateEventActionCommandOutputOptional
options: HttpHandlerOptionsOptional
data: UpdateRevisionCommandOutputOptional
data: UpdateRevisionCommandOutput
AWS Data Exchange is a service that makes it easy for AWS customers to exchange data in the cloud. You can use the AWS Data Exchange APIs to create, update, manage, and access file-based data set in the AWS Cloud.
As a subscriber, you can view and access the data sets that you have an entitlement to through a subscription. You can use the APIs to download or copy your entitled data sets to Amazon Simple Storage Service (Amazon S3) for use across a variety of AWS analytics and machine learning services.
As a provider, you can create and manage your data sets that you would like to publish to a product. Being able to package and provide your data sets into products requires a few steps to determine eligibility. For more information, visit the AWS Data Exchange User Guide.
A data set is a collection of data that can be changed or updated over time. Data sets can be updated using revisions, which represent a new version or incremental change to a data set. A revision contains one or more assets. An asset in AWS Data Exchange is a piece of data that can be stored as an Amazon S3 object, Redshift datashare, API Gateway API, AWS Lake Formation data permission, or Amazon S3 data access. The asset can be a structured data file, an image file, or some other data file. Jobs are asynchronous import or export operations used to create or copy assets.